  • 3 Decades in the making, memories for a lifetime!

    The sole reason for why I’m blessed to be in this awesome hobby! This will forever be one of the greatest moments of my life. I was able to fly Papa’s J3 Piper Cub for him that he built 3 decades ago. Papa always knew how much I loved that plane and surprised me with it 5 years ago. I am so happy I was able to finish it for him to see it fly while he was still with us. Papa was the sole reason I’m in this great hobby today and I owe him everything for that. Papa passed away few few weeks ago and an awesome 93 years old and will be greatly missed. I love you and will miss you every time I fly. I know you are smiling down upon us.
